How to get from Stop 68A Womma Rd - South West side to Daw Park by bus and train?
From Stop 68A Womma Rd - South West side to Daw Park by bus and train
To get from Stop 68A Womma Rd - South West side to Daw Park in Adelaide, take the GAWC train from Womma station to Adelaide station. Next, take the G21 bus from Stop A2 King William Rd - East side station to Stop 15 Goodwood Rd - East side station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 34 min. The ride fare is A$2.40.
